Daegu
7.1/10
$2,100/month · South Korea
GO- Significantly cheaper than Seoul for rent and daily costs
- Excellent Korean food scene with famous markets
- KTX high-speed rail to Seoul in under 2 hours
- Nicknamed "Daegu the Furnace" — summers regularly exceed 37°C
- English proficiency is noticeably lower than Seoul
- Smaller international community and fewer coworking spaces
Hsinchu
7.0/10
$2,100/month · Taiwan
GO- Heart of Taiwan's semiconductor and tech industry
- Fast internet and tech-oriented infrastructure
- Young, educated population with international exposure
- Famous for persistent, strong winds (nicknamed "Windy City")
- Limited cultural and nightlife attractions
- City revolves around the science park — feels corporate
